JACK50N <br />Application of a Revenue Bond Issue for $2,500,000.00 <br />for and on behalf of MMOB, LTD., has been made for the acquisition <br />and construction of a medical office building located at 629 North <br />Michigan Street, South Bend, Indiana. <br />This expansion will mean an increase in employment. It is <br />estimated that this new facility will result in the employment of <br />approximately ten (10) new jobs and bring an annual payroll increase <br />of $60,000.00 to $310,000.00. <br />It is properly zoned and it will be a further expansion <br />in our South Bend area. <br />KPF /gwo <br />Verb truly yours, <br />ETH P—.
